Gemini API 使い方 初心者向け無料入門ガイド

初心者がGemini APIのキーを無料で取得してPython開発を始めるイメージ図 AI・テクノロジー
AI開発への第一歩。Gemini APIを使えば、無料で高性能なAIを自分の手に。
スポンサーリンク

要点:2026年現在、Googleが提供するGemini APIは、無料枠が非常に充実しています。

Pythonなどのコードを使って初心者でも簡単に生成AIを活用したシステムやアプリケーションを構築できるのが最大の魅力です。

AI技術の進化により、GoogleのGeminiは2025年から2026年にかけて、マルチモーダル(テキスト、画像、音声などを同時に処理する能力)においてChatGPTを超えるほどの精度と速度を実現しました。

本記事では、プログラミング初心者の方がAPIキーを取得します。

Pythonで最初のプログラムを実行するまでの手順を詳しく解説します。

Google AI Studioを活用すれば、ブラウザ上で試しに生成を実行することも可能です。

初心者がGemini APIのキーを取得して開発を始めるイメージ図
スポンサーリンク
知識ゼロからAI開発へ。Gemini APIは初心者の強力な味方です。
スポンサーリンク

Gemini API チュートリアル:APIキー取得の方法

要点:Gemini APIを利用するための最初のステップは、Google AI Studioにログインします。

独自のAPIキー(key)を作成・取得することです。

これによりGoogleの最新モデルへのアクセスが可能になります。

APIとは、アプリケーションが外部のサービス(ここではGoogleのAI)と連携するための窓口のようなものです。

Google AI Studioは、開発者が無料でモデルを試すためのプラットフォームであり、複雑な設定なしで利用を開始できます。

Google AI StudioでAPIキーを発行する

まず、Googleアカウントを用意して公式サイトにアクセスしましょう。

Gemini API 無料枠の制限と注意点

Gemini APIには、初心者が試しに使うのに十分な無料枠が設けられています。

注釈:APIキー サービスを利用するためのパスワードのようなもの。他人に知られないように管理する必要があります。

注釈:リクエスト AIに対して「文章を作って」などの指示を送ること。1回送るごとに1リクエストとカウントされます。

Google AI Studioでの初期設定とモデル選択のコツ

要点:Google AI Studioにログインし、最新のmodels一覧から適切なものを選択することは、初心者がAI開発をスムーズに開始するための重要な準備です。

アカウント設定を正しく行うことで無料かつ安全に生成機能を使用できます。

2025年から2026年にかけて、GoogleのAIプラットフォームは劇的な進化を遂げました。

Googleアカウントさえあれば、誰でも気軽にGemini APIを試しに使うことができます。

複雑な認証手続きも最小限に抑えられています。

Google AI Studioのモデル選択メニューと設定画面
モデルの選定。目的のタスクに最適な知能を選択します。

モデル一覧から用途に合わせた選択を行う

Google AI Studioでは、複数の生成モデルが提供されています。

初心者がまず確認すべきは、modelsの種類とその特性です。

アカウントの準備と課金設定の変更

APIを継続的に活用する際には、プロフィールの変更やプロジェクト名の登録など、管理画面での操作も必要になります。

最後に、作成したシステムが意図した形式で出力されているか、ユーザーの視点で検証を行いましょう。

from句を用いたPythonのコード実装へ進む前の、この細かな設定が成功の秘訣です。

Gemini API Pythonでの導入と実装手順

要点:PythonはAI開発で最も人気のある言語です。

Googleが提供する公式ライブラリをインストールすることで、数行のコードでAIの応答を出力させることができます。

プログラミングを始めたばかりの方でも、Pythonならシンプルな記述で実装が完了します。

pipコマンドを使ってライブラリを環境に整え、実際にAIとやり取りしてみましょう。

Google AI Studioの画面でAPIキーを新規作成する手順のキャプチャ
APIキーの取得。これがAIモデルを動かすためのパスワードになります。

ライブラリのインストールとインポート

まずはターミナルまたはコマンドプロンプトを開き、以下のコマンドを実行します。

Bash

pip install -q -U google-generativeai

インストールが完了したら、Pythonスクリプトの冒頭でライブラリをimportします。

Python

import google.generativeai as genai
import os

# 先ほど取得したAPIキーを設定
genai.configure(api_key="あなたのAPIキー")

Gemini API サンプルコード:最初の生成

最も基本的なテキスト生成の例を紹介します。modelとして「gemini-1.5-flash」を選択します。

Python

model = genai.GenerativeModel('gemini-1.5-flash')
response = model.generate_content("こんにちは!自己紹介をして。")
print(response.text)

このコードを実行すると、AIからの応答が表示されます。

response.textの部分で、生成されたテキスト内容を受け取って表示しています。

Google AI Studio を活用したプロトタイピング

要点:コードを書く前にGoogle AI Studioを使うことで、ブラウザ上でプロンプトのテストやパラメータの調整をリアルタイムに行うことができます。

開発の効率が飛躍的に向上します。

初心者にとって、いきなりプログラミングを行うのはハードルが高いかもしれません。

Google AI Studioでプロンプトのテストを行っている操作画面
試作の場。Google AI Studioでプロンプトの感度を調整しましょう。

プロンプトのテストとシステム指示

AI Studioでは、AIに特定の役割(キャラクターや専門家)を持たせるシステム指示(system instructions)を試すことができます。

コードの自動生成機能

AI Studioで良い結果が得られたら、画面右上の「Get Code」ボタンをクリックしてみましょう。

Gemini API エラーへの対処法とドキュメントの読み方

要点:開発****中に発生するエラーは、APIキーの設定不備や制限の超過が原因であることが多く、公式ドキュメントやエラーメッセージを正しく確認することで迅速に解決できます。

プログラミングにエラーはつきものです。

大切なのは、エラーを恐れずにその内容を理解しようとすることです。

エラーメッセージが表示された画面を冷静に修正するエンジニア
トラブル解決。エラーメッセージを読み解くことが上達への近道です。

よくあるエラーメッセージと原因

公式ドキュメントの歩き方

Googleの公式サイト(Google AI Developers)には、膨大なリファレンスが掲載されています。

2026年最新トレンド:マルチモーダル活用とGemini Nano

要点:2026年のGemini APIは、テキストだけではありません。

上記をシームレスに扱うマルチモーダル機能が標準化されました。

スマホなどのデバイス上で動くGemini Nanoとの連携も注目されています。

生成AIの世界は、単なるチャットボットを超えて、より高度な機能へと進化しています。

APIを使って、画像から説明文を生成したり、長文を要約したりするアプリが小規模な開発でも実現できるようになりました。

AIが画像の内容を分析してテキストを出力するイメージ図
画像認識。視覚情報を言語化する機能がアプリの可能性を広げます。

画像とテキストを組み合わせた入力

Gemini APIは、画像を読み取ってその内容を言葉で説明させることが得意です。

Gemini Nano とオンデバイスAI

2026年は、クラウドを経由せずにスマートフォン内のチップでAIを動かすGemini Nanoが普及しました。

よくある質問(FAQ):Gemini API の疑問を解決

要点:初心者がGemini APIを使い始める際に抱き****やすい、料金や商用利用、ChatGPTとの違いなどの疑問に対し、最新の情報に基づいてお答えします。

Q1. Gemini API は本当に無料で使えますか?

はい、無料プランが用意されています。 Google AI Studioで取得したAPIキーを使えば、一定のリクエスト数までは完全に無料です。

ただし、無料枠で送信したデータは、Googleのモデル改善(学習)に利用される可能性があります。

機密情報は送らないようにしましょう。

Q2. 商用利用は可能ですか?

可能です。

ただし、無料プランではなく有料プラン(従量課金制)を選択する必要があります。

有料プランであれば、送信したデータが学習に使われることはなく、ビジネス用途でも安全に利用できます。

Q3. ChatGPT(OpenAI)のAPIと何が違いますか?

2026年時点での比較では、GeminiはGoogle検索との統合による最新情報への強みや、Google Workspace(Gmail、ドライブなど)との連携のしやすさが大きなメリットです。

また、長大なドキュメントを一度に読み取れるコンテキストの広さ(トークン数)においても、Geminiは非常に優れています。

Q4. 日本語での精度はどうですか?

非常に高いです。

Geminiは開発段階から日本語を含む多言語をサポートしております。

自然な日本語で応答します。

2026年最新のモデルでは、日本の文化や慣習を理解した、より的確な回答が返ってくるようになっています。

まとめ:AI開発の第一歩を踏み出そう

Gemini APIの使い方を学ぶことは、あなたがAIという強力なツールを自在に操れるようになるための大きな一歩です。

最初は難しいと感じるかもしれませんが、Google AI Studioでボタンを押し、Pythonで最初の「Hello World」ならぬ「Hello Gemini」を出力できたときの感動は、これからのエンジニア人生においてかけがえのないものになるでしょう。

明るい未来へ向けてAI開発を続けるエンジニアの姿
未来へ。あなたの創造力が、Gemini APIを通じて形になります。

2026年の最新技術を味方につけて、自分だけのAIアプリケーションを構築してみてください。

失敗を恐れず、公式ドキュメントやコミュニティを活用しながら、一歩ずつ進んでいきましょう。

サイト外リンク

有効な内部リンク

スポンサーリンク
タイトルとURLをコピーしました